What is Sports Psychology?

Sports psychology is a branch of psychology that focuses on how individuals use psychological principles and techniques to improve their athletic performance. It is closely related to other sports science disciplines, including kinesiology, physiology, and exercise physiology. It is used by athletes, coaches, and trainers to maximize performance and achieve their goals.

Benefits of Sports Psychology

Sports psychology can help athletes to:

  • Develop a positive attitude and increase confidence
  • Learn positive self-talk and use of visualization techniques
  • Enhance performance with relaxation and concentration techniques
  • Improve goal setting and motivation
  • Develop mental toughness and focus

Mental Toughness

Mental toughness is an important part of athletes’ performance. It is defined as the ability to stay focused and remain confident under pressure, both internally and externally. It is the ability to push through the challenges and keep going despite the difficulty. Sports psychology can help athletes to develop their mental toughness by teaching them how to focus on the task at hand, and how to mentally prepare for competition. This can include learning mental strategies to manage emotions, enhance concentration, and improve resilience.

Focus

Focus is another key aspect of athletes’ performance. It is the ability to concentrate on the task at hand, and to maintain a consistent level of performance despite distractions. Sports psychology can help athletes to develop their ability to focus by teaching them how to recognize and eliminate distractions, and how to maintain consistent concentration and motivation throughout their competitions.
